Opinionated About Elderly People

How the world views treats older people Not today you're in the way Older people are boring they're wild awake and snoring Some have prosthetic teeth Some never awake there're always sleep It's very, very hard to meet and greet Take them seventeen minutes to cross the street Place them in a home, just leave them there alone In a nice room with flowers Send someone there pay them minimum wage just to shower What about that next hour, I myself forgot We will visit them on Mother's/Father's, Grandparent and Uncle Riley day What's the meaning is of "feed them hay" I don't know, I'm so afraid What's the matter with them anyway? Hands are shaking, feet are bad Fell/fall down at the kitchen table hit their head Some want to go to bed at day round eight O'clock in the morning, Well Their an waste of time, they eat their own slime no wait that's the babies You don't understand they can't shake your hand No grip no pun intended How do you remind them Don't whisper when you walk And don't yell when you talk All this and you still remember chalk Well I'm going away from here You don't have to come see bout' me well I'm just an old timer Because my name is Foretime cause.. I forgot about you? 08/24/15 by James Edward Lee Sr. from" 2015 Poetry to Bridge Generations UNO Elderly and Youth"
